The address is a stand‑alone unit. It is part of the residential development built by AVJennings in Bligh Park
The unit offers three bedrooms and one bathroom, providing comfortable accommodation for a small family or couple
The property sits on a 765 m² land parcel, giving ample outdoor space around the unit
Bligh Park contains a small local shopping centre with a grocery store, bakery, pharmacy and other services, all located within the suburb and easily reachable from the unit
Windsor Downs Nature Reserve is approximately 0.8 km away, offering nearby opportunities for walking and enjoying native bushland
Bligh Park features two large sporting ovals, Bounty Reserve and Colonial Reserve, that serve local cricket, soccer and junior rugby league clubs
Bligh Park lies about 58 km west of the Sydney CBD, placing the property within a reasonable commuting distance to the city
